Data governance has emerged as a critical discipline in the modern enterprise landscape, ensuring that data is managed effectively and responsibly. It encompasses a wide array of activities aimed at ensuring data quality, accessibility, and compliance with regulatory requirements. This article delves into the key activities involved in data governance and identifies the associated challenges that organizations often encounter.
1、Establishing a Governance Framework:
The first step in data governance is to establish a comprehensive framework that outlines the roles, responsibilities, and processes involved. This involves identifying key stakeholders, defining data governance policies, and creating a governance structure. The challenge lies in aligning the governance framework with the organization's strategic objectives and ensuring that it is adaptable to evolving business needs.
2、Defining Data Ownership and Stewardship:

Assigning clear ownership and stewardship responsibilities is crucial for effective data governance. Data owners are responsible for ensuring data quality and accessibility, while stewards manage the day-to-day operations of data management. The challenge here is to identify the right individuals for these roles and establish a culture of accountability and collaboration.
3、Developing Data Policies and Standards:
Creating robust data policies and standards is essential for maintaining data quality and consistency. This involves defining data classification, data retention, and data privacy policies, as well as establishing data quality standards. The challenge is to strike a balance between enforcing strict standards and allowing flexibility for business-specific requirements.
4、Ensuring Data Quality:
Data quality is a key concern in data governance. Organizations need to implement data quality controls, including data profiling, data cleansing, and data validation. The challenge lies in identifying and addressing the root causes of data quality issues, such as incomplete or inconsistent data.
5、Data Integration and Master Data Management:
Integrating data from various sources and managing master data are critical activities in data governance. This involves identifying data sources, establishing data integration processes, and maintaining a single source of truth for master data. The challenge is to ensure that the integration process is efficient and scalable, while also addressing data silos and data redundancy.
6、Ensuring Data Security and Compliance:

Data governance must address data security and compliance with regulatory requirements, such as GDPR and HIPAA. This involves implementing data access controls, encryption, and monitoring data usage. The challenge is to balance security and compliance with the need for data accessibility and business agility.
7、Establishing a Culture of Data Governance:
Creating a culture of data governance is crucial for long-term success. This involves promoting data governance awareness, training employees, and encouraging data-driven decision-making. The challenge is to foster a mindset that values data quality, accessibility, and compliance, and to overcome resistance to change.
Challenges in Data Governance:
1、Resistance to Change:
Implementing data governance often requires significant changes to existing processes and systems. Employees may resist these changes due to concerns about increased workload or loss of autonomy. Overcoming resistance requires effective communication, stakeholder engagement, and leadership support.
2、Lack of Resources:
Data governance requires dedicated resources, including personnel, technology, and budget. Many organizations struggle to allocate sufficient resources to data governance initiatives, leading to suboptimal results.

3、Complexity of Data Environments:
Modern organizations deal with complex data environments, including diverse data sources, formats, and technologies. Managing this complexity requires a comprehensive understanding of the data landscape and the ability to adapt to evolving requirements.
4、Aligning Data Governance with Business Objectives:
Ensuring that data governance aligns with business objectives can be challenging. It requires a deep understanding of the organization's strategic goals and the ability to translate these goals into actionable data governance initiatives.
5、Integrating Data Governance with Existing Systems:
Integrating data governance with existing systems and technologies can be difficult. It often requires customizing or modifying existing solutions, which can be time-consuming and costly.
In conclusion, data governance is a multifaceted discipline that involves a wide array of activities and challenges. By understanding the key activities involved in data governance and addressing the associated challenges, organizations can establish a robust and effective data governance framework that supports their strategic objectives and ensures the responsible management of data.
